The role in a nutshell:

The HR Services Manager plays a pivotal role in delivering high-quality, legally compliant HR Business Partnering support to a diverse portfolio of global clients, including Embedded clients (reseller) and HR Consulting clients. As the primary HR point of contact for workers, clients, and in-country partners, this role is responsible for effectively managing the full employee lifecycle and ensuring seamless coordination across all HR functions with defined service scope, SLAs and workflows. The ideal candidate should have a strong understanding of employment law, HR best practices, and the ability to lead complex HR initiatives in a fast-paced, global environment. This role also requires creative thinking, a can-do attitude, and a proactive, consultative approach to client needs. The HR Services Manager must anticipate client needs, provide up-front knowledge to mitigate risk, and ask probing questions to uncover the full context of client inquiries.

How you will make a difference:
  • Act as the primary HR point of contact for GEO workers and client stakeholders, delivering professional and compliant support across the full employee lifecycle (onboarding to offboarding).
  • Provide day-to-day HR and benefits support, including guidance on statutory and supplemental benefits (eligibility, enrollment, changes), ensuring clear and effective worker communication.
  • Deliver HR and benefits briefings aligned with local labor laws and company policies to ensure understanding and compliance.
  • Advise clients on performance management, promotions, career development, and compensation benchmarking with a consultative, solutions-oriented approach.
  • Support Embedded (reseller) and HR Consulting clients with tailored HR guidance, adhering to defined communication protocols, service standards, and process controls.
  • Prepare and manage employment contracts and HR documentation (offers, confirmations, compensation/title changes, probation extensions, renewals), while proactively tracking key dates such as probation periods and contract expirations.
  • Ensure compliance with local labor laws, GDPR, and internal policies by maintaining accurate employee records, HR documentation, and up-to-date policies and handbooks.
  • Collaborate with payroll and benefits vendors to ensure accurate payroll processing, tax filings, and social security submissions.
  • Support work permit processes (applications, renewals, cancellations) in coordination with legal and immigration partners.
  • Proactively identify and mitigate legal, compliance, and operational risks; escalation complex employee relations or legal matters as needed.
  • Lead and support HR initiatives and projects, including employee transitions, organizational changes, and terminations.
  • Partner cross-functionally with Sales, Operations, Legal, and Finance teams to ensure aligned and efficient HR service delivery.
  • Generate HR reports, support audits and due diligence processes, and respond to internal or client data requests.
  • Enhance employee experience through onboarding, engagement initiatives, regular check-ins, and effective offboarding processes.
  • Act as an escalation point for employee concerns, grievances, and conflict resolution, ensuring timely and appropriate action.
  • Identify process inefficiencies and implement improvements to optimize HR operations and reduce compliance risks.
  • Stay updated on employment laws and HR best practices across supported regions to continuously improve service quality
